Fan-out backpressure for the Quillet notifier: when the queue depth crosses the soft limit, the dispatcher sheds low-priority pushes and batches the rest at 500ms intervals. Reviewer should confirm the shed counter is exported and that retries respect the jitter window. Once merged, the release artifact gets re-signed by the pipeline, which expects the deploy key shown below.

deploy key for bawep-yawif: bky6_GQhaSt

### First-Day Checklist — Item 7: Loading Dock Hours

Brief the new starter: Penmore House dock runs 08:00–15:30, weekdays only. No weekend deliveries. Couriers outside hours get redirected to front desk. New starters collecting equipment from the dock should go before 15:00. Dock office staffed until 16:00. Log every collection in the dock book. Entry to the dock corridor requires the standard pass code noted below.

turnstile pass: bdg-NG-3

Welcome to the QuotaLoom provenance page. Short version: every build of the per-tenant rate-quota service is stamped at publish time, so we can always tie a quota decision back to the exact artifact that made it. Handy when a tenant disputes throttling. The currently deployed artifact is identified by the token just below.

session token of bawep-yadup = htk21_528abd376e3c5a4ec24a1

## Runbook: Phrasewright extraction script

Quick notes for reviewing changes to the Phrasewright extractor. The script walks the template tree, pulls tagged strings, and writes a catalog per locale. Watch for two things in reviews: regexes that silently skip multi-line tags, and anyone bumping the batch size past what the catalog writer can flush. If extraction hangs, it's almost always a lock left by a crashed run. The script picks up its settings from the block below.

service settings:
PRAWYN_PIN=9848
PRAWYN_METRICS_HOST=metrics.prawyn.lumicworks.corp
PRAWYN_LOG_LEVEL=warn
PRAWYN_TENANT=pelius

Subject: Handover — Ledgerline export release duties

Hi team, passing the baton to Marisol for the Ledgerline release cycle. Heads up for support: the spreadsheet export memory spike is fixed in 5.2 — exports over 200k rows now stream instead of buffering, so those OOM tickets should dry up. Hotfix builds must be verified with the current release signing key, which is.

signing key of bagap-yawep = bky13_TbfT6ZMUoGJo2